Ingredients
1 ½
lbs.
Ground beef
1
C.
Onion, chopped
3
oz.
Cream cheese
1
Packet
Taco seasoning
1
Can
Green chilis
2-3
C.
Fritos corn chips
1
C.
Shredded taco blend cheese
1
Roma Tomato
Tomato
1-2
C.
Shredded lettuce
Salsa and sour cream for garnish
Instructions
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Place ground beef and chopped onions in an oven-safe skillet, saute until browned.
Add taco seasoning, green chilis, and cream cheese, ensuring a thorough mix.
Layer Fritos corn chips and shredded cheese over the mixture, then bake for 20 minutes.
Garnish with shredded lettuce, tomatoes, and your preferred garnishes. Serve and enjoy!
